In many instances it is the … WebOdorant is a volatile liquid that is added to natural gas and propane prior to distribution in pipelines as a safety precaution to make it smell. It helps detect a gas leak because natural gas and propane are odorless. The two most common odorants are methyl mercaptan (for natural gas) and ethyl mercaptan (for propane and n-butane).

Helium is mined along with natural gas, using a drill rig to drill wells deep into the earth’s crust. A drill rig must penetrate a layer called the Cap Rock to reach a natural gas reserve.
